England: The Classic Pie

Meat Pie

In England, no visit to a football match is complete without indulging in a traditional meat pie. Whether you opt for the classic steak and kidney or a chicken and mushroom variant, these hearty pastries are perfect for enjoying in the stands. Pair it with some mushy peas or gravy for the ultimate comfort food.

Fish and Chips

For a coastal twist, many seaside clubs offer fish and chips. Enjoy crispy battered fish served with golden fries. It’s a meal that will keep you energized throughout the match!

Spain: Tapas and More

Chorizo al Vino

In Spain, the matchday experience is vibrant and flavorful. One popular dish to try is chorizo al vino (chorizo in wine). This spicy sausage dish is typically served with crusty bread, making it perfect for sharing with friends before the game.

Paella

Some stadiums in Spain might even offer mini paellas, a nod to this iconic rice dish. Whether you prefer seafood or a meat version, it’s a delicious way to embrace Spanish culture on matchday.

Germany: Bratwurst and Pretzels

Bratwurst

In Germany, the atmosphere surrounding football matches is electric, and the food is just as exciting. Grab a bratwurst sausage, grilled to perfection and served in a bun. It’s a simple yet flavorful option that pairs well with mustard and sauerkraut.

Pretzels

Don’t forget to try a giant pretzel! Soft, warm, and sprinkled with coarse salt, these are a must-have snack that will keep you munching through the game.
